MacTalk Gets iPhone Rumor Takedown Notice
Monday, June 8th, 2009 at 9:46 AM - by Jeff Gamet
MacTalk is running one fewer iPhone rumor stories thanks to a cease and desist letter. The now missing post claimed that Vodafone Australia listed Apple's 16GB iPhone as a discontinued product, which many are taking as a confirmation that new iPhone models will be announced during the World Wide Developer Conference on Monday, according to Macworld.
Anthony Agius, MacTalk owner, commented "I can't say who the C&D is from, but if you go through the MacTalk blog, you might notice a missing post regarding an iPhone rumour."
While Mr. Agius doesn't say who the takedown request came from, which was most likely part of the takedown request. The lack of information, however, has left readers to speculate whether or not it was Apple issuing the request, or if the letter came from Vodafone Australia or its supplier, Brightpoint.
Apple is expected to introduce new iPhone models along with iPhone Software 3.0 during its keynote presentation at WWDC in San Francisco. The event is scheduled to kick off at 10AM pacific time, and TMO will be on site with live coverage.
